Abstract:
Provided is a technique that makes it possible to achieve a higher performance in purifying an exhaust gas. An exhaust gas-purifying catalyst according to the present invention includes a substrate, and a catalytic layer facing the substrate and including a precious metal, alumina, an oxygen storage material, and a sulfate of an alkaline-earth metal having an average particle diameter falling within a range of 0.01 to 0.70 µm, the average particle diameter being obtained by observation using a scanning electron microscope.
Abstract:
Provided is an exhaust catalyst that exhibits higher NO X -reducing activities at the time of engine restart while maintaining its catalytic activities during normal traveling. This invention provides an exhaust cleaning catalyst 7 comprising a substrate 10 and a catalyst coating layer 30 that includes CeO 2 . Catalyst coating layer 30 is constituted in its thickness direction with multiple coating layers. In a top coating layer 50 located at the outermost surface, the CeO 2 content in a top coating layer's upstream portion 51 is less than the CeO 2 content in a top coating layer's downstream portion 52; and the CeO 2 content in the top coating layer's upstream portion 51 is less than the CeO 2 content in a lower coating layer 40. The CeO 2 content per liter of catalyst volume in the entire coating layer is 10 g/L to 30 g/L.
